Output 51f07b39805640c6378788f3b3931fa1cf8ed0042a00056cbafceaea02f93a92:1

value
537061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bed1f78eef64cfcf6ec03fd44827a3ce0d29f81 OP_EQUAL
address
3A55UbEFjnEDHAU2DH4EJpdxk71R9gwGes
transaction
51f07b39805640c6378788f3b3931fa1cf8ed0042a00056cbafceaea02f93a92
spent
true